Which Is a Property of an Angle?

Quick answer

An angle is formed by two rays (its sides) that share a common endpoint called the vertex, and its size is measured in degrees. The defining property is two rays meeting at a single vertex — that is what identifies a figure as an angle.

The answer

The defining property of an angle is that it is formed by two rays that share a common endpoint. Those two rays are the sides (or arms) of the angle, and the shared endpoint where they meet is the vertex. The "opening" between the two rays is the angle, and its size is measured in degrees (from 0° up to 360°) using a protractor.

So when a question asks "which is a property of an angle?", the correct choice is the one describing two rays with a common endpoint (a vertex). Everything else about angles — that they are measured in degrees, that they can be acute or obtuse — follows from this basic structure.

Why the other options are wrong

Typical multiple-choice distractors and why they miss:

  • "Two parallel lines": Parallel lines never meet, so they cannot share a vertex and cannot form an angle. Wrong.
  • "A single ray" or "a single line": One ray or line by itself has no opening and no vertex where two arms meet, so it is not an angle. You need two rays.
  • "Two line segments of equal length": Angle size has nothing to do with how long the sides are drawn. You can extend or shorten the rays and the angle stays the same, because the measure depends only on the amount of turn between them, not their length.
  • "It is measured in centimeters": Length is measured in centimeters; angles are measured in degrees (or radians). Choosing a length unit confuses the two.

The reliable answer is the option that captures two rays meeting at a vertex (and, if offered, that it is measured in degrees).

The bigger picture

Once you know the parts — two sides (rays) and one vertex — the rest of angle geometry falls into place. The measure tells you how far one ray is rotated from the other:

  • Acute angle: less than 90°
  • Right angle: exactly 90° (a square corner)
  • Obtuse angle: between 90° and 180°
  • Straight angle: exactly 180° (the two rays point in opposite directions, forming a line)
  • Reflex angle: between 180° and 360°

An important and often-tested fact: the length of the rays does not change the angle. Two angles can look different in size on paper simply because one has longer arms, yet have the identical measure. What matters is the amount of turn at the vertex. This is why a protractor measures the opening, not the drawing. Understanding that an angle is fundamentally "two rays sharing a vertex, measured by the turn between them" lets you answer not just this question but any that asks you to identify, classify, or compare angles.

Frequently asked

What are the parts of an angle?

An angle has three parts: two sides (also called arms), which are rays, and a vertex, the common endpoint where the two rays meet. The space between the two rays is the angle itself, measured in degrees.

What is the vertex of an angle?

The vertex is the point where the two rays of an angle meet — the shared endpoint of both sides. It is the corner of the angle, and the angle's measure describes how far apart the two rays open from that vertex.

How is an angle measured?

An angle is measured in degrees using a protractor, ranging from 0° to 360° (or in radians in higher math). The measure reflects the amount of turn between the two rays, not the length of the rays, which does not affect the angle.

What are the different types of angles?

By measure: acute (less than 90°), right (exactly 90°), obtuse (between 90° and 180°), straight (exactly 180°), and reflex (between 180° and 360°). These categories all describe the size of the opening between the angle's two rays.
